Marit Aaseng of Alexandria, studio art and psychology major and daughter of Grant and Ruth Aaseng, and Catherine Lovrien of Alexandria, undecided major and daughter of Martin and Judith Lovrien, were recognized for academic achievement at the annual Honors Day convocation at St. Olaf College in Northfield on May 4.
Honors Day recognizes students who have a cumulative grade point average of 3.60 or higher and those who have been awarded scholarships and fellowships, including Fulbright scholars, Goldwater scholars and senior members of leadership and academic honor societies.
